Overcoming Common Challenges in Push Notification Implementation

Push notifications are a powerful mobile marketing tool, allowing businesses to engage with users directly on their devices. However, implementing an effective push notification strategy can be challenging. Many marketers face hurdles such as user opt-in rates, message personalization, and timing of delivery. To overcome these challenges, it is essential to prioritize user consent and provide value in each notification. Users are more likely to opt in if they see tangible benefits, such as exclusive offers or important alerts. Personalizing messages based on user behavior helps increase engagement. It’s not just about sending alerts; it’s about sending relevant content that speaks to the individual. Marketers should also test different times for notifications to understand when users are most responsive. This means considering various time zones, user habits, and preferences to maximize effectiveness. Monitoring performance and adapting strategies based on analytics can lead to better outcomes. It’s crucial to craft messages that resonate with users, being brief yet informative. Therefore, continued assessment and adjustment are vital to achieving success with push notifications.

Another significant challenge in push notification implementation is maintaining a balance between frequency and user fatigue. While consistency is key for keeping users engaged, too many notifications can lead to frustration. It is important to strike the right balance by establishing a clear communication strategy. Segmenting users according to their preferences and behaviors can help in targeting specific groups with relevant content while minimizing unnecessary messages. Through A/B testing, marketers can identify optimal frequencies that maintain engagement without overwhelming users. Understanding the audience is crucial; businesses must consider peak usage times and preferred content to tailor messages effectively. Moreover, it’s essential to educate users on the benefits of opting into notifications. Clear communication about what types of messages they can expect can help minimize unsubscriptions. A robust onboarding process that explains the value of notifications sets the tone for user expectations. Users should feel in control of their notification settings, allowing them to choose preferences. Thus, creating an engaging user experience matters. Regularly updating notification content also keeps the audience interested while reducing potential fatigue.

Message Content and Relevancy

The content of the push notifications is paramount. Messages must be concise, captivating, and relevant to the audience to encourage interaction. Using an attention-grabbing subject line, along with emojis can enhance visibility and appeal. It’s crucial to tailor messages to specific audiences using data analytics to inform decisions. Utilizing user behavior, demographics, and preferences allows for personalized experiences that resonate with recipients. Implementing rich media elements, such as images, videos, or interactive buttons, can further enhance engagement rates. Instead of standard text notifications, rich notifications offer a more immersive experience. For example, including direct links to content or actions allows users to engage with just a tap, improving user experience. Crafting a clear call to action (CTA) is essential. Users should know exactly what to do next, whether it’s viewing a special offer or reading a new article. Consistently reviewing and optimizing message formats will contribute to higher click-through rates. Additionally, creating urgency through time-sensitive notifications can prompt immediate responses, increasing user interaction and driving traffic effectively.

The implementation of push notifications also brings legal compliance into play, especially concerning user data and privacy. Following regulations such as GDPR and CCPA is crucial to maintain user trust. Marketers need to ensure that they obtain clear consent before sending notifications. This includes providing transparent information about data collection, usage, and expiration policies. Users should have the ability to opt-out easily at any time without feeling pressured. Implementing a straightforward and user-friendly unsubscribe process is vital to maintaining a positive relationship with consumers. Regularly reviewing compliance strategies ensures alignment with evolving laws. Moreover, companies must educate their teams about these regulations actively. Compliance training can enhance understanding among marketers, fostering a culture of respect for user privacy. Building trust is essential in mobile marketing, as users appreciate transparency about how their data is being used. Therefore, businesses should prioritize ethical practices while building their push notification strategies. By emphasizing privacy, they can create a more user-centric approach that differentiates their messaging and remains beneficial.
